Originally Posted by Guy Legend
4 inches longer than the current LS long wheel base....woah.
Yep, dimensions are definitely indicating the next LS in disguise....


LF-FC is nearly four inches longer, four inches wider and two inches lower than the current LS 460L sedan. The growth also makes the concept longer than the current segment leader: Mercedes-Benz’s venerable S class.
